About Exclaim Robotics
We're a small robotics company building robots to maintain critical infrastructure, starting with data centers.
Compute density in AI data centers is skyrocketing, which is forcing changes to rack dimensions and cooling, and above all to power. Those changes make a rack a worse place for a person to work. Most of the data center is controlled remotely anyway, so the physical tasks that remain are small and very precise: replacing an optical network connector without dislodging its neighbors, reconfiguring copper wiring, and replacing NVMe drives exactly straight, all through a mess of cables. The robot has to be reliable enough that people trust it near a rack that costs millions of dollars.
We're in pre-seed, and everything is still being built: the team, the company, the robots. If that sounds exciting rather than worrying, this might be the right place for you!

What You'd Be Doing
You'd be our first machine learning engineer, and the plan you'd be carrying out, and arguing with, goes roughly like this. Train a privileged policy in simulation, where we know exactly where every drive bay and connector is. Distill it into something that only gets to see what the robot can see. Then close the gap on real hardware, with residual RL or with imitation from teleop demonstrations. Simulation comes first, because the robot arms are still on order.

Most of the work is the pipeline around that plan, and none of it exists yet. You'd set up training, decide what data gets collected and what gets thrown away, and keep experiments in a state where we can actually tell which change helped. Data curation is the part nobody puts in a job ad, and it is most of what makes a policy work.

Someone else will worry about making the policy run fast on the robot. You would still be expected to go and stand next to the robot and watch it fail, because that is where you find out what your training distribution was missing.

What You Need to Bring:

  • You've trained a policy that controlled something physical, either a real robot or one in a robotics simulator. Show us a repo, a paper, or a video of it running.

  • A university-level degree in robotics, machine learning, or something adjacent. If you've managed to teach yourself to fully understand research papers without one, still happy to talk.

  • Depth in RL or in imitation learning: sim training and reward shaping, or diffusion policies, ACT, and behavior cloning from demonstrations. Both belong here, fine if you're only experienced with one.

  • You can build the training pipeline yourself, data in and checkpoints out, with experiments tracked somewhere we can read them. Weights and Biases is fine, and so is whatever has replaced it by the time you read this.

  • Comfortable in a simulator, Isaac Sim/Lab or MuJoCo or similar, including the unglamorous half of building scenes and randomizing them.

  • You don't need to be a controls or systems engineer, but you do need to care whether the policy works on hardware rather than in a notebook.
